The Hagger One-Name Study

What is the study about?

The Hagger One Name Study, is being co- ordinated by Peter Hagger. It was started towards the end of 2003 after Peter and Martin Hagger attended a seminar organised by the Guild of One-Name Studies. The study is registered with the Guild of One-Name Studies and the names registered with the Guild are Haggar, Hagger, Hagar and Hager. However, we are also collecting information on a number of variants including: Haga, Hagar, Hager, Haggar, Haggarjudd, Haggaer, Hagger, Haggers, Haggerwood, Haggor. The study aims to collect as much information about people with the Hagger name, construct family trees and where possible prove a connection between families. The study is also interested in establishing the possible source or sources of the name.
